首页 >> 精选问答 >

秦九韶算法详解

2025-10-09 20:27:59

问题描述:

秦九韶算法详解,急!求解答,求不敷衍我!

最佳答案

推荐答案

2025-10-09 20:27:59

秦九韶算法详解】秦九韶算法,又称“秦氏算法”或“正负开方法”,是中国古代数学家秦九韶在《数书九章》中提出的一种用于求解高次方程根的数值方法。该算法不仅在当时具有重要意义,而且对后世数学发展产生了深远影响,尤其在代数计算和数值分析领域有着广泛应用。

一、算法原理简述

秦九韶算法主要用于求解多项式方程的根,特别是实数根。其核心思想是通过递推的方式将多项式表达式转化为一种嵌套形式,从而简化计算过程。这种方法避免了直接展开多项式的复杂运算,提高了计算效率和准确性。

例如,对于一个多项式:

$$

f(x) = a_n x^n + a_{n-1}x^{n-1} + \cdots + a_1 x + a_0

$$

可以通过秦九韶算法将其改写为:

$$

f(x) = (((a_n x + a_{n-1})x + a_{n-2})x + \cdots )x + a_0

$$

这种形式便于逐层计算,减少了乘法次数,提升了计算效率。

二、算法步骤总结

步骤 操作说明
1 将多项式按照降幂排列,并列出所有系数 $ a_n, a_{n-1}, \ldots, a_0 $
2 设初始值 $ b_n = a_n $
3 对于每个 $ i = n-1, n-2, \ldots, 0 $,计算 $ b_i = b_{i+1} \times x + a_i $
4 最终得到的 $ b_0 $ 即为多项式在 $ x $ 处的值

三、应用与优势

特点 说明
计算效率高 减少了乘法次数,适用于高次多项式
易于编程实现 结构清晰,适合用循环结构实现
稳定性好 在一定范围内能有效逼近真实根
可用于近似求根 配合其他方法(如牛顿迭代)可提高精度

四、历史意义与现代价值

秦九韶算法是中国古代数学智慧的结晶,体现了早期数学家对代数运算的深刻理解。在没有计算机的时代,这一算法为手算提供了极大的便利,也推动了数学理论的发展。

在现代,秦九韶算法被广泛应用于数值分析、工程计算以及计算机科学中,成为多项式求值的标准方法之一。其思想也被推广到多项式插值、函数逼近等领域。

五、示例演示

以多项式 $ f(x) = 2x^3 - 6x^2 + 4x - 5 $,求在 $ x = 3 $ 处的值。

按秦九韶算法:

$$

\begin{align}

b_3 &= 2 \\

b_2 &= b_3 \times 3 + (-6) = 2 \times 3 - 6 = 0 \\

b_1 &= b_2 \times 3 + 4 = 0 \times 3 + 4 = 4 \\

b_0 &= b_1 \times 3 + (-5) = 4 \times 3 - 5 = 7 \\

\end{align}

$$

因此,$ f(3) = 7 $

六、总结

秦九韶算法是一种高效、实用的多项式求值方法,具有重要的历史价值和现实意义。它不仅展示了中国古代数学的卓越成就,也为现代数学和工程计算提供了基础支持。掌握这一算法,有助于更好地理解和应用多项式相关的数学问题。

  免责声明:本答案或内容为用户上传,不代表本网观点。其原创性以及文中陈述文字和内容未经本站证实,对本文以及其中全部或者部分内容、文字的真实性、完整性、及时性本站不作任何保证或承诺,请读者仅作参考,并请自行核实相关内容。 如遇侵权请及时联系本站删除。

 
分享:
最新文章